Package SOT-23-6 SOT-23-6
Description SENSOR DIGITAL -55C-125C SOT23-6 SENSOR DIGITAL -55C-125C SOT23-6
Supplier - Texas Instruments,Rochester Electronics, LLC
Part Status Active Active
Sensor Type Digital, Local Digital, Local
Sensing Temperature - Local -55°C ~ 125°C -55°C ~ 125°C
Output Type 2-Wire Serial, I²C/SMBUS I²C/SMBus
Voltage - Supply 2.7V ~ 5.5V 2.7V ~ 5.5V
Resolution 12 b 11 b
Features Shutdown Mode One-Shot, Output Switch, Programmable Resolution, Shutdown Mode, Standby Mode
Accuracy - Highest(Lowest) ±2°C ±2°C (±3°C)
Test Condition -25°C ~ 85°C (-55°C ~ 125°C) -25°C ~ 85°C (-55°C ~ 125°C)
Operating Temperature -55°C ~ 125°C -55°C ~ 125°C
Mounting Type Surface Mount Surface Mount
Series Automotive, AEC-Q100 -
Sensing Temperature - Remote -55°C ~ 125°C -
